Are people in El Reno older or younger than people in Fort Polk South?
- The Median Age in El Reno is 14.4 years older than in Fort Polk South.

Are housing costs cheaper in El Reno or Fort Polk South?
- El Reno housing costs are 16.1% more expensive than Fort Polk South housing costs.

Which city has a longer commute, El Reno or Fort Polk South?
- The average commute for residents of El Reno is 2.5 minutes shorter than it is for residents of Fort Polk South.

Things to do in El Reno?
El Reno, Oklahoma is a vibrant city situated to the west of Oklahoma City. It offers plenty of activities for visitors such as golfing and fishing at nearby Lake El Reno, or shopping at unique stores downtown. For those looking for a true western experience, there are rodeos and heritage sites in El Reno that offer a glimpse into the Old West. Additionally, El Reno has many outdoor parks and trails perfect for hiking or picnicking. Whether you’re looking for a day trip or planning to stay longer, El Reno provides something exciting for everyone.
